Make the best use of intelligence

Counterintelligence plays a critical role in a proactive security strategy. It’s a critical resource in the world of espionage, and it’s also the case when defending a distributed environment. Fortunately, IT security teams have a distinct advantage because they have access to the kind of threat intelligence and resources that cybercriminals generally do not. Threat intelligence feeds, augmented with machine learning and AI, can help detect and respond to threats before they can successfully compromise a system or network.

Deception technology has become critical to counterintelligence, where false network traffic and devices are generated to entice and confuse attackers, filling the environment with tripwires that can alert security systems and teams of any unexpected or unauthorized behavior. Cyber adversaries will need to differentiate between legitimate and deceptive traffic in real time, without also getting caught for simply monitoring traffic patterns.

As organizations add playbooks, behavioral analytics and more pervasive AI to their deception strategies, they will effectively tighten this proactive approach even further. This lets the IT security team create a controlled environment that allows attackers to roam freely so the team can detect how the attackers operate.

Security teams need continuous updates of good threat counterintelligence based on the latest adversaries’ playbooks. By doing so, organizations can detect and respond to any counterintelligence efforts before they happen, keeping the upper hand in the ongoing cyber war.

Forge more partnerships and coordination

With the scale, resources, and speed utilized by many current attacks, it’s also essential that organizations must not rely on a “lone wolf” approach. They cannot expect to defend against cyber adversaries on their own. They need to actively engage in threat sharing so that they can stay forewarned against emerging threats. They also need to know who to inform in the case of an attack so that the “fingerprints” of the attack are properly shared, helping to build or improve attacker playbooks, as well as to assist law enforcement in doing its work.

Threat research organizations, cybersecurity vendors, multinational organizations, and other industry groups also must partner with law enforcement and legislatures to help dismantle adversary infrastructures to prevent future attacks. There are no borders in cyberspace, so the fight against cybercrime needs to go beyond borders, as well, to include the global threat-fighting community. We need to empower law to pursue cybercriminals across borders to take down their safe havens.

Don’t think that this means going on the attack – it’s about finding ways to work together, to work smarter, to focus on partnerships, and to improve on the intelligence we have. Only by working together can we turn the tide against cybercriminals.
